- [ ] **Health checks behind the Larkfield load balancer.** Before sealing the ceremony keys, confirm all four Quillgate app nodes return healthy on the internal probe endpoint. Drain any node failing two consecutive checks and note it in the ceremony log. The balancer's admin console requires the custodian credential minted earlier in this ceremony; if that credential was rotated, the console falls back to passphrase entry. Enter the recovery passphrase recorded below.

vault phrase of tajef-tafog = istox-sorax-zorox-casok-holox-kelix-weneth-drueth-casion

## Support

As of release 4.2, Ledgerpine exports payroll batches in the v3 columnar format; the legacy fixed-width format is retained behind the `--legacy-pay` flag but will be removed next quarter. Maintainers should verify downstream importers at Quillbrook Staffing accept v3 before deleting the shim in `export/payfmt.go`. If you hit edge cases not covered in the migration notes, reach out to the payroll platform team at the address below.

alerts address for bajop-yahog: istwyn@lumiclabs.internal

Ticket: Staging env misconfigured for Siftgate bloom filter

The bloom layer in front of the Pellet KV store is rejecting all lookups in staging because the env file was copied from the dev template without credentials. False-positive tuning values are fine; only the auth line is missing. To unblock the weekly demo, the Pellet admission secret must be set on the following line.

env line for yaguf-fajop: LEDGER_TOKEN13=fb08984397349

Subject: Rotation — Wikihaven RBAC service key

Maintainers: the key used by the Wikihaven role-sync job (maps groups to wiki roles via the internal Gatekept API) rotates tonight. Old key dies at midnight. Update the sync job's config before then or role changes will stall. Nothing else changes. The replacement key follows below.

app token of kagap-fahag = zpat2_0m

If the Bramblehook API contract tests fail on pagination, check that the fixture dataset still exceeds one page; a trimmed seed file silently makes cursor tests pass vacuously. Regenerate seeds with the `fullseed` task before re-running. The CI image where this behavior was last reproduced and fixed is referenced below.

pipeline stamp: htk9_6ce9d33c5